What Is Dysport?

Dysport is an FDA-approved injectable that uses abobotulinumtoxinA to smooth moderate to severe frown lines. Known for its natural diffusion and quick onset, Dysport has become a preferred choice for many seeking a refreshed appearance.

How Does Dysport Work?

Your provider administers Dysport through multiple small injections into targeted muscles. The formula's unique spreading properties mean fewer injection points may be needed. Results develop quickly and look naturally refreshed.

1 How quickly does Dysport work?

Dysport typically shows results within 2-3 days, which is faster than Botox. Full effects are visible within 2 weeks. Rose Hill practitioners are trained in current best practices.

2 Who should not get Dysport?

Dysport is not recommended for those with allergies to botulinum toxin, milk protein allergies, or certain neuromuscular conditions. Pregnant and breastfeeding women should avoid it.

3 What should I avoid after Dysport?

Avoid rubbing the treated area, lying down, and strenuous exercise for 4-6 hours. Avoid alcohol for 24 hours to minimize bruising. Rose Hill med spas follow the same protocols with local expertise.

4 Is Dysport cheaper than Botox?

Per unit, Dysport costs less than Botox, but more units are typically required. The total cost per treatment is generally comparable. Consult a Rose Hill provider for personalized guidance.

5 How long does Dysport last?

Dysport results typically last 3-4 months, similar to Botox. Some patients report slightly different durations between the two. Your Rose Hill provider can give specific recommendations.

6 Can Dysport treat areas other than frown lines?

While FDA-approved for glabellar lines, Dysport is often used off-label for forehead lines, crow's feet, and other areas similar to Botox. Rose Hill practitioners are trained in current best practices.

7 Can I switch between Dysport and Botox?

Yes, you can switch between products. Many patients try both to see which works better for them. Allow the previous treatment to fully wear off before switching.
